Output daefd855e81caedbe54a67522442c681609d73cdaa988fbd135ef88d44ab2011:3

value
3900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ddf605012dae9276f4b80e423bdf01fca92f240 OP_EQUAL
address
3BhyAuTXZ76Q9ZJEYque46LGt8aBRXbwtX
transaction
daefd855e81caedbe54a67522442c681609d73cdaa988fbd135ef88d44ab2011
spent
true